Bacon Cheddar Gnocchi Soup: A Cozy, Indulgent Delight
A creamy and hearty soup featuring the delightful combination of bacon, cheddar cheese, and tender gnocchi.

-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x

- 4 slices bacon
- 1 cup gnocchi
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 teaspoon thyme
- Salt and pepper to taste
- In a large pot, cook the bacon over medium heat until crispy. Remove and chop.
- Add the diced onion and cook until translucent.
- Stir in the garlic and thyme, cooking for another minute.
-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er.
- Add gnocchi and cook until tender.
- Stir in heavy cream and shredded cheddar until melted.
- Mix in the cooked bacon and season with salt and pepper.
- Serve hot, garnished with additional cheese if desired.
Notes
- For a vegetarian version, omit the bacon and use vegetable broth.
- Adjust the thickness by adding more or less cream.
